Your Competitive Advantage Comes From a Great Data Asset
The Data Driven Podcast was joined by Tristan Rouillard, a co-Founder of Hasty.ai. Hasty.ai supports vision AI practitioners and their evolving needs by developing best-in-class vision AI tools that are supported by a community of machine learning engineers, data scientists, and software developers.
Some of the topics that Tristan and I discussed:
- The genesis of the idea for Hasty came from the founders’ own experiences
- Manual image labeling and just how time-consuming that is
- The idea was NOT to change the technology but to change the process
- The necessity to bring the neural networks into the process earlier on
- The importance of having a clean data set
- With Hasty, one is not looking for mistakes in the dataset, but fixing the ones the neural network has found
- There is no substitute for a ground-truth data set
- When you are building a product, you are looking for ‘love’ and ‘wow’
- Hasty is changing a process and that is the hardest thing to change
- Bringing agile methodology to machine learning
- How sometimes the biggest competition is the status quo
- Taking domain-specific assets and leveraging them in a good way
- Data ownership and one of Hasty’s USPs
- It is likely that the training data is the differentiator, not the neural network
- The nuance and complexity of image recognition is yet to be understood
- The need for data documentation
- Hasty is teaching machines how to identify and see the world the same way we do
- Everybody that joins Hasty has to label a data asset
